A novel NiO/potato peels nanocomposite was successfully synthesized via a facile hydrothermal process for the efficient removal of fluoride from water. The structural and morphological properties of the composite were confirmed by XRD, FTIR, and SEM. Adsorption kinetics followed a pseudo-second-order model, indicating chemisorption as the dominant mechanism. Response Surface Methodology (RSM) based on a Box-Behnken Design (BBD) was employed to optimize the adsorption process. The optimal conditions for maximum fluoride adsorption were determined to be an adsorbent dosage of 1 g/L, a pH of 7, and a contact time of 480 minutes. Under these optimized conditions, the nanocomposite achieved a high adsorption capacity and reduced fluoride concentration below the WHO permissible limit of 1.5 mg/L within just two hours. The composite also exhibited excellent regeneration capability over five cycles. This study demonstrates the potential of this sustainable, waste-derived nanocomposite as a highly effective adsorbent for fluoride remediation in water.
